On Sat, Oct 22, 2011 at 08:19:33PM +0400, Pavel Lunin wrote: > > As far as I understand, it's not really correct to compare difficulty > of these two operations, since they are performed by two different > units inside the chip. While label lookup instead of full IP table can > dramatically simplify the lookup unit's life, the unit, which inspects > packets and extracts bits from them, must be still quite complex even > for label-only router. Hashing ALU's life is not a peace of cake > either. Say, EX series PFE use only 6-bit seeds to construct hash on > them. In case you want to push a whole 20-bit label to the hash seed, > I'm afraid, you'll need more bits in ALU registers, more cycles or > something else.
Well, nobody said it was EASY, just EASIER. :) The point is, just by going from full tables to not-full-tables you can start taking advantage of existing commodity chips which CAN do IP and some pretty deep hashing already, and move from thousands of dollars per 10GE and 80-120G/slot (MX/ASR-style) down into hundreds of dollars per 10GE and 480-640G/slot. Personally my take is that PTX missed the mark as far as interesting target customer size goes. There are still a *LOT* of places where you could very easily replace a $1mil core T/CRS box at $retardecarrier with a $10-20k 1-2U box that does 64x10GE, or 40GE, etc. But obviously Juniper doesn't want to canibalize from their own T (or at worst MX) market, which is why only made the PTX product that they did (pick between massive or super-$%^&ing massive, and at only ~MX-style port prices). Eventually someone will come along and realize that there is an untapped market here, and then the promise of cheap label switching routers will be fulfilled. IMHO the reasons this hasn't happened yet are a) only Cisco/Juniper *REALLY* have a good handle on the software side of MPLS, and b) not enough non-carriers are currently running (or even currently able to conceptualize running) label-only cores.
